Output 2548c3d14449d0ee679401cb0818ccb3a984ab1d0434e0a112f2f3b3e664d88e:59

value
624133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2882560e9c90c731e075deff2a50403149b69db9 OP_EQUAL
address
35PD68cqdkcAy3UfcU79BYArbJdfuDfPxA
transaction
2548c3d14449d0ee679401cb0818ccb3a984ab1d0434e0a112f2f3b3e664d88e